Delphi-PRAXiS
Seite 2 von 3     12 3      

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i Mage Zahlen!?! (https://www.delphipraxis.net/27445-mage-zahlen.html)

Tubos 10. Aug 2004 20:49

Re: Mage Zahlen!?!
 
200 Millionen Stellen ist eine Zahl, die man nicht verwenden kann weil es keine Entsprechungen in der realen Welt gibt.
Obwohl ein Computer damit rechnen könnte, ist das völlig sinnlos.

Habe das mal grob durchgerechnet:
Eine 1 mit 200 Millionen Nullen îst seeeeehr viel mehr als die Anzahl der Atome in unserem Universum.
Das ist nämlich eine 1 mit 116 Nullen, also nur 117 Stellen.
Und großzügigerweise habe ich zur Sternmasse nochmal 10.000 multipliziert ;)

Vergiss es, du brauchst solche Zahlen nicht.

obbschtkuche 10. Aug 2004 22:05

Re: Mage Zahlen!?!
 
Für jede Zahl gibt es Verwendung. Vielleicht will er ja errechnen wie viele Möglichkeiten es gibt ein paar Tausend Sehenswürdigkeiten zu besuchen?

Zitat:

...weil es keine Entsprechungen in der realen Welt gibt.
Da fällt mir aber gleich noch mehr ein: Gewicht des Universums in... ähm... Yoctogramm oder die Zahl der Quarks im Universum... :hi:

phXql 10. Aug 2004 22:22

Re: Mage Zahlen!?!
 
Zitat:

...weil es keine Entsprechungen in der realen Welt gibt.
anzahl der möglichen querverbindungen von allen sternen zueinander :mrgreen:

ripper8472 10. Aug 2004 23:44

Re: Mage Zahlen!?!
 
Zitat:

Zitat von Tubos
...weil es keine Entsprechungen in der realen Welt gibt.

alle möglichen chemischen Verbindungen aller Atomarten und deren Isotopen bis zur Kernladungszahl 200, maximal so komplex wie es mit allen Atomen im All geht *g*
vielleicht kommen ja gute Medikamente oder neues Semtex raus...

Tubos 11. Aug 2004 21:34

Re: Mage Zahlen!?!
 
Zitat:

Da fällt mir aber gleich noch mehr ein: Gewicht des Universums in... ähm... Yoctogramm oder die Zahl der Quarks im Universum...
Anzahl der Quarks ist nicht viel mehr.
Ich habe keine Ahnung wie groß die Dinger sind, aber selbst wenn ein Atom aus einer Million Quarks besteht, ändert sich kaum was am Ergebnis ;)

dizzy 11. Aug 2004 23:13

Re: Mage Zahlen!?!
 
[ot]Ein Proton/Neutron besteht je aus 3 Quarks: 2 Up + 1 Down bzw. 2 Down + 1 Up -Quark. Elektronen sind im wesentlichen schon soetwas wie Quarks :zwinker:[/ot]

Tabak 15. Aug 2004 22:06

Re: Mage Zahlen!?!
 
Hi Leute,
erstmal sorry, dass ich nimmer geschrieben hab, aber mein Router..... :wall:
Is echt cool was ihr da über 200 Millionenstellenzahlen philosophiert!! Bin beeindruckt! Deshalb lüfte ich auch das Geheimnis (etwas sehr durchgeknallt):
Ich hab mir überlegt, dass wenn man einfach den Farbwert von jedem Pixel in eine lange Zahl schreibt, müsste man doch mit Exponent-Funktionen die Zahl auch hinbekommen. - Sone Art Komprimierung.
Zur Verdeutlichung: Mal angenommen wir nehmen alle 3 Farben mit(000-255) bei einer Auflösung von 1024 * 768. So müsste man immer 9 Ziffern für einen Pixel reserviren (Z.B 255255255000000000255255255 wäre dann ein weißer, ein schwarzer und ein weißer Pixel )bei der Auflöung von 1024*768 wären das also 9*1024*768 = 7077888.
Bei 30 Bildern ca 212336640 Ziffern - ein Zahl die unglaublich viel Speicher bräuchte... Eine Lösung wären Exponenten: 10 hoch 10
= 100000000000 (12 Ziffern), 10.000^10.000 = noch viel größer. Man speicher einfach die Exponentfunktion, wandelt es wieder in 200 Mio.Ziffern um und freut sich jedes mal über den Rechner Absturz :zwinker:
- Ich wollt eigentlich nur wissen ob das mal abgesehen von der Rechenleistung machbar wäre...

gmarts 15. Aug 2004 23:03

Re: Mage Zahlen!?!
 
...wäre schon toll, wenn deine Ziffernfolge ne glatte Zehnerpotenz wäre.
Das wäre bei deiner Methode wohl nur bei vollkommen schwarzen Bildern so, deren erster Pixel dunkelrot ist. :mrgreen:

Sonst ist die Schreibweise in Zehnerpotenzen alles andere als praktisch:
  • 1234 = 1*10^3 + 2*10^2 + 3*10^1 + 4*10^0 = 12*10^2 + 34*10^0 = 1234*10^0
Wie du es auch machst....du sparst nichts ein.

Tabak 15. Aug 2004 23:48

Re: Mage Zahlen!?!
 
Ja hast recht, wenn man es mit 10 Potzenzen machen würde wäre wohl ziemlich viel schwarz dabei 8) .
War aber auch nur ein Beispiel. bei 3^17 = 129140163 müsste ein grau mit leichtem blaustich rauskommen. Wenn sichs um große Zahlen handelt kann man ja auch mit Komma Zahlen arbeiten und es lohnt sich trotzdem, oder einfach sagen er soll noch 12345 dazuadieren - falls es halt benötigt wird. Mehrfachexponenten wären auch möglich (3^7^13,654 - was immer da für eine Farbe rauskommen würde). Nur eine Frage der Funktionen...

Stevie 16. Aug 2004 07:36

Re: Mage Zahlen!?!
 
Zitat:

Zitat von LeoDD
Früher hat man sowas mit Strings nachgebildet. Vielleicht is das einfacher.

Bei 200 Millionen Stellen hätte eine Variable dieses Datentyps einen Speicherbedarf von ca. 190 MB !!!


Alle Zeitangaben in WEZ +1. Es ist jetzt 19:46 Uhr.
Seite 2 von 3     12 3      

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z